You can use https://t.co/4PJvda0eDy to cross-check values and bit patterns for quantized floating point numbers from the @OpenComputePrj's Microscaling Formats (MX) spec -- both variants of both fp8 & fp6, the scaling-only e8m0 format, and the minuscule fp4.
